Don Ed Hardy’s memoir, “Wear Your Dreams,” offers a unique glimpse into the world of tattoo artistry. Hardy, a legendary figure in the industry, shares his life’s journey through ink. With heartfelt anecdotes and stunning visuals, the book provides a comprehensive perspective on how tattooing has shaped his life and artistic career. In April 1942, Lale Sokolov, a Slovakian Jew, is forcibly transported to the concentration camps at Auschwitz-Birkenau. When his captors discover that he speaks several languages, he is put to work as a Tätowierer (the German word for tattooist), tasked with permanently marking his fellow prisoners. The Tattoo History Source Book is an exhaustingly thorough, lavishly illustrated collection of historical records of tattooing throughout the world, from ancient times to the present. Collected together in one place, for the first time, are texts by explorers, journalists, physicians, psychiatrists, anthropologists, scholars, novelists, criminologists, and tattoo artists.
